Antithrombin
What this test measures
Antithrombin is a protein made by the liver that switches off thrombin and several other activated clotting factors, acting as one of the body's natural brakes on clotting. It is also the protein through which heparin works. The test measures how active it is, reported as a percentage of the amount found in pooled normal plasma.
Why doctors request it
Doctors request it as part of a thrombophilia screen after an unexplained clot, particularly in a young person or with a strong family history, and occasionally when heparin appears to be working less well than expected.
What commonly pushes it up
- Warfarin, slightly
- There are no common medical causes of a high antithrombin and a high value is not of any importance
What commonly pushes it down
- Inherited antithrombin deficiency, which is uncommon
- Heparin, while it is being given
- Liver disease, because less is made
- Nephrotic syndrome, where it is lost in the urine
- A severe illness that uses up clotting factors
- A recent clot, surgery or major illness
- Oestrogen-containing medicines and pregnancy, slightly
- Asparaginase, a cancer medicine
Everyday reasons for a value outside the range
- A level measured during or just after a clot, an operation or heparin use reads low and is repeated once recovered
- Oestrogen-containing contraception or HRT lowers it a little as an expected effect
- Pregnancy lowers it a little as an expected change
About the sample
No fasting needed. Citrate tube. Best measured when well, off heparin, and at least a few weeks after any clot or operation.
